Eugene Kaspersky probably hates malware just as much as you do on his own machines, but as the head of Kaspersky Labs, the world's largest privately held security software company, he might have a different perspective — the existence of malware and other forms of online malice drives the need for security software of all kinds, and not just on personal desktops or typical internet servers. The SCADA software vulnerabilities of the last few years have led him to announce work on an operating system for industrial control systems of the kind affected by Flame and Stuxnet. But Kaspersky is not just toiling away in the computer equivalent of the CDC: He's been outspoken in his opinions — some of which have drawn ire on Slashdot, like calling for mandatory "Internet ID" and an "Internet Interpol". He's also come out in favor of Internet voting, and against SOPA, even pulling his company out of the BSA over it. More recently, he's been criticized for ties to the current Russian government. (With regard to that Wired article, though, read Kaspersky's detailed response to its claims.) Now, he's agreed to answer Slashdot readers' questions. On Your Exploit-Free OS (Score:5, Interesting)
Architecturally, the operating system is constructed in such a way that even a break-in into any of the components or applications loaded onto it won’t allow an intruder to gain control over it or to run malicious code.
Could you expound on this? Are you writing this code or still in the design phase? Or better yet, could you compare it to something like, say, CentOS or Debian and tell us how your architecture is going to be more secure? I understand you're scoping down the requirements of your OS to be more easily manageable but the skeptic in me feels like it just can't be done. The cat and mouse game must be played in some form or fashion.

Re:On Your Exploit-Free OS (Score:4, Interesting)
Well, yes, but I think Kaspersky is advocating that we swing the pendulum in the opposite direction: instead of making trade-offs against security, we make a niche OS that makes all of its trade-offs in favor of security, trying to keep in mind the specific needs of industrial control systems. He's also advocating -- if you'll forgive me -- a paradigm shift, in which security becomes the mantra, rather than stability. This is unsurprising, coming from a security professional. I can't say whether he's an ideological fool or a visionary, but they are not mutually exclusive.
Of course, convincing people to use an operating system that made all of its trade-offs against ease-of-use, backwards compatibility, features, and stability may end being even harder than writing it.

A read-only OS is called a Live CD (or more generally Live distro, since they're rarely used from CDs anymore). The downside of course is that updates are more challenging.
If you can netboot, you can get the advantages of a read-only system while not being a pain to update by simply making sure the network machines can't write to whatever they're booting from. Anonymous Internet IDs (Score:5, Interesting)
Do you believe everyone could be issued an ID, and still remain anonymous? What I mean is, I believe that you could ensure each of your users is unique, but not necessarily know who they are. If everyone is issued a certificate signed by some trusted authority, one could verify that the certificate is valid, without the certificate exposing the information about who you are. You could even have a scheme that lets the authority issue you multiple IDs, but only one for each unique ForUseWithDomain attribute, such that if you wanted to keep your identity from being correlated across different sites, you could do so. This could probably even be automated.
This would ensure that if you banned a malicious user from your site, they wouldn't be able to come back without compromising someone else's certificate. Yet, you still get a high level of anonymity.
Sites that require non-anonymous access could deny anonymous certificates, and require that you authorize access to full name perhaps. This would be like OpenID in the way it will prompt you for a site requesting additional information, like your email.

Ken Thompson's Hack (Score:5, Interesting)
One of the threats I expect to see more of is in the vein of Ken Thompson's hack [bell-labs.com], where a compiler (or any other build tool) hosts a trojan and infects other programs it compiles (or links, assembles, etc.) practically undetectably. With open-source software taking an ever-more-vital role in the Internet's core systems, will this kind of attack be easier to detect (perhaps due to the widespread availability of still-clean compilers), or more difficult (perhaps due to the wide network of trusted developers)?

Re: (Score:2)
No, actually, you can't. Its computationally infeasible to find deliberately hidden malware in a body of code, whether source or object. So no amount of analysis and/or testing can ever reliably tell you whether in fact your existing system is corrupt. You can only accomplish that by starting with a formal set of requirements that you can then successively refine into code that is (a) minimal, and (b) demonstrably maps directly to your formal specifications and their requirements. malware history and future (Score:1)
You've been in computer security a long time, and have seen many things come and go.
DOS/bootsector viruses, Windows viruses, macro viruses, rise of worms to replace them, and now the commercialization of malware with botnets, extortion-ware and the targeted weaponised malware like the one that hit Iran (and who knows what else).
What's changed? What's remained the same? What about the malware creators - has their motivation changed?
Where do you believe things are headed?
